Troubleshooting
Problem
Error thrown while creating EAR with webservices enabled in WebSphere Application server - ClassNotFoundException
Symptom

Cause
The issue was with the JDK being used internally by WebSphere's Java2WSDL utility.
In 9.4, the product jars are compiled using JDK 1.7. WebSphere Application Server 8.5.5 by default uses JDK 1.6 for the Java2WSDL utility hence it is not able to the read the product jar files present in the classpath.
Resolving The Problem
Update WebSphere Application server profile command default JDK to 1.7 to resolve the issue.
You may use managesdk command present in WebSphere/AppServer/bin to switch the JDK version.
Example: managesdk.bat/sh -setCommandDefault -sdkname 1.7_64
